1. The servo controller can easily convert the operation module and Fieldbus
module through the automation interface,
At the same time, different fieldbus modules are used to realize different
control modes (RS232, RS485, optical fiber, INTERBUS, PROFIBUS). The control
mode of general frequency converter is relatively single.
2. The servo controller is directly connected with the resolver or encoder to
form a closed loop of speed and displacement control. The general frequency
converter can only form an open-loop control system.

- Q: 2500KVA transformer bearing current how much calculation
- Did not give the voltage data to transformer primary and secondary side rated voltage 10KV / 0.4KV as an example: Primary side rated current: I = P / 1.732 / U = 2500 / 1.732 / 10 ≈ 144 (A) Secondary side rated current: I = P / 1.732 / U = 2500 / 1.732 / 0.4 ≈ 3609 (A)
- Q: What are the specifications of the transformer capacity?
- Select the transformer capacity, to the existing load as the basis, appropriate consideration of load development, select the transformer capacity can be determined in accordance with the 5-year power development plan. When 5 years of power development is clear, little change and then the load is not less than 30% of the transformer capacity: ?? ?SN = KS ΣPH / (cosφ η) ?? ?Where: SN - box change in 5 years required configuration capacity, kVA ΣPH - 5 years old with financial calculations, kW KS - at the same time, generally 0.7 to 0.8 Cosφ - power factor, generally 0.8 ~ 0.85 Η - transformer efficiency, generally 0.8 ~ 0.9 ?? ?According to the formula generally KS = 0.75, cosφ = 0.8, η = 0.8 ?? ?SN = 0.75ΣPH / (0.8 × 0.8) = 1.17ΣPH ?? ?Example: a district in accordance with 50W / m2 design, then ?? ?PH = 50 × 19200 = 960kW ?? ?SN = 1.17 x 960 = 1123 kW ?? ?So the district selected three 400kVA transformer.

- Q: I was testing a transformer I had bought, and I tested the voltage at 30v, then i proceeded to test the current, I connected both of the outputs from the secondary to a 1 ohm 25watt resistor, that is one on each side, then I connected my meter to it. I got a reading of 3.2 amps, but then it just kept falling, when I disconnected it, it had gone down to 2.75 and was still going. Does that mean I connected it wrong, I dont see how it could be wrong, but I dont understand why the current was falling. Any help?
- If you bought this transformer it should have a VA rating in other words a voltage x amps rating. This gives the maximum current on both primary and secondary Example if you bought a 300VA transformer with a 30Volt secondary the maximum current is 300/30 10 amps absolute maximum You then match the load so as not to exceed this value and also you install 10 amp fuses to protect the transformer from burning out. If you do not know the VA rating then start with a high value resistor or better still a potentiometer and slowly decrease the resistance whilst measuring the current until the transformer starts to get hot The load and ammeter should be in series not in parallel
